gi-gtk-3.0.2: Gtk bindings

CopyrightWill Thompson, Iñaki García Etxebarria and Jonas Platte
LicenseLGPL-2.1
MaintainerIñaki García Etxebarria (garetxe@gmail.com)
Safe HaskellNone
LanguageHaskell2010

GI.Gtk.Objects.TreeView

Contents

Description

 

Synopsis

Exported types

newtype TreeView Source

Constructors

TreeView (ForeignPtr TreeView) 

Instances

Methods

treeViewAppendColumn

treeViewCollapseAll

data TreeViewCollapseAllMethodInfo Source

Instances

((~) * signature (m ()), MonadIO m, TreeViewK a) => MethodInfo * TreeViewCollapseAllMethodInfo a signature Source 

treeViewCollapseRow

treeViewColumnsAutosize

treeViewConvertBinWindowToTreeCoords

treeViewConvertBinWindowToWidgetCoords

treeViewConvertTreeToBinWindowCoords

treeViewConvertTreeToWidgetCoords

treeViewConvertWidgetToBinWindowCoords

treeViewConvertWidgetToTreeCoords

treeViewCreateRowDragIcon

treeViewEnableModelDragDest

treeViewEnableModelDragSource

treeViewExpandAll

data TreeViewExpandAllMethodInfo Source

Instances

((~) * signature (m ()), MonadIO m, TreeViewK a) => MethodInfo * TreeViewExpandAllMethodInfo a signature Source 

treeViewExpandAll :: (MonadIO m, TreeViewK a) => a -> m () Source

treeViewExpandRow

data TreeViewExpandRowMethodInfo Source

Instances

((~) * signature (TreePath -> Bool -> m Bool), MonadIO m, TreeViewK a) => MethodInfo * TreeViewExpandRowMethodInfo a signature Source 

treeViewExpandToPath

data TreeViewExpandToPathMethodInfo Source

Instances

((~) * signature (TreePath -> m ()), MonadIO m, TreeViewK a) => MethodInfo * TreeViewExpandToPathMethodInfo a signature Source 

treeViewGetActivateOnSingleClick

treeViewGetBackgroundArea

treeViewGetBinWindow

treeViewGetCellArea

treeViewGetColumn

treeViewGetColumns

treeViewGetCursor

treeViewGetDestRowAtPos

treeViewGetDragDestRow

treeViewGetEnableSearch

treeViewGetEnableTreeLines

treeViewGetExpanderColumn

treeViewGetFixedHeightMode

treeViewGetGridLines

treeViewGetHadjustment

treeViewGetHadjustment :: (MonadIO m, TreeViewK a) => a -> m Adjustment Source

Deprecated: (Since version 3.0)Use gtk_scrollable_get_hadjustment()

treeViewGetHeadersClickable

treeViewGetHeadersVisible

treeViewGetHoverExpand

treeViewGetHoverSelection

treeViewGetLevelIndentation

treeViewGetModel

data TreeViewGetModelMethodInfo Source

Instances

((~) * signature (m (Maybe TreeModel)), MonadIO m, TreeViewK a) => MethodInfo * TreeViewGetModelMethodInfo a signature Source 

treeViewGetNColumns

treeViewGetPathAtPos

treeViewGetReorderable

treeViewGetRubberBanding

treeViewGetRulesHint

treeViewGetRulesHint :: (MonadIO m, TreeViewK a) => a -> m Bool Source

Deprecated: (Since version 3.14)

treeViewGetSearchColumn

treeViewGetSearchEntry

treeViewGetSelection

treeViewGetShowExpanders

treeViewGetTooltipColumn

treeViewGetTooltipContext

treeViewGetVadjustment

treeViewGetVadjustment :: (MonadIO m, TreeViewK a) => a -> m Adjustment Source

Deprecated: (Since version 3.0)Use gtk_scrollable_get_vadjustment()

treeViewGetVisibleRange

treeViewGetVisibleRect

treeViewInsertColumn

treeViewInsertColumnWithDataFunc

treeViewIsBlankAtPos

treeViewIsRubberBandingActive

treeViewMapExpandedRows

treeViewMoveColumnAfter

treeViewNew

treeViewNewWithModel

treeViewRemoveColumn

treeViewRowActivated

data TreeViewRowActivatedMethodInfo Source

Instances

((~) * signature (TreePath -> b -> m ()), MonadIO m, TreeViewK a, TreeViewColumnK b) => MethodInfo * TreeViewRowActivatedMethodInfo a signature Source 

treeViewRowExpanded

treeViewScrollToCell

treeViewScrollToPoint

data TreeViewScrollToPointMethodInfo Source

Instances

((~) * signature (Int32 -> Int32 -> m ()), MonadIO m, TreeViewK a) => MethodInfo * TreeViewScrollToPointMethodInfo a signature Source 

treeViewSetActivateOnSingleClick

treeViewSetColumnDragFunction

treeViewSetCursor

data TreeViewSetCursorMethodInfo Source

Instances

((~) * signature (TreePath -> Maybe b -> Bool -> m ()), MonadIO m, TreeViewK a, TreeViewColumnK b) => MethodInfo * TreeViewSetCursorMethodInfo a signature Source 

treeViewSetCursorOnCell

treeViewSetDestroyCountFunc

treeViewSetDestroyCountFunc :: (MonadIO m, TreeViewK a) => a -> Maybe TreeDestroyCountFunc -> m () Source

Deprecated: (Since version 3.4)Accessibility does not need the function anymore.

treeViewSetDragDestRow

treeViewSetEnableSearch

data TreeViewSetEnableSearchMethodInfo Source

Instances

((~) * signature (Bool -> m ()), MonadIO m, TreeViewK a) => MethodInfo * TreeViewSetEnableSearchMethodInfo a signature Source 

treeViewSetEnableTreeLines

treeViewSetExpanderColumn

treeViewSetFixedHeightMode

treeViewSetGridLines

treeViewSetHadjustment

data TreeViewSetHadjustmentMethodInfo Source

Instances

((~) * signature (Maybe b -> m ()), MonadIO m, TreeViewK a, AdjustmentK b) => MethodInfo * TreeViewSetHadjustmentMethodInfo a signature Source 

treeViewSetHadjustment :: (MonadIO m, TreeViewK a, AdjustmentK b) => a -> Maybe b -> m () Source

Deprecated: (Since version 3.0)Use gtk_scrollable_set_hadjustment()

treeViewSetHeadersClickable

treeViewSetHeadersVisible

treeViewSetHoverExpand

data TreeViewSetHoverExpandMethodInfo Source

Instances

((~) * signature (Bool -> m ()), MonadIO m, TreeViewK a) => MethodInfo * TreeViewSetHoverExpandMethodInfo a signature Source 

treeViewSetHoverSelection

treeViewSetLevelIndentation

treeViewSetModel

data TreeViewSetModelMethodInfo Source

Instances

((~) * signature (Maybe b -> m ()), MonadIO m, TreeViewK a, TreeModelK b) => MethodInfo * TreeViewSetModelMethodInfo a signature Source 

treeViewSetModel :: (MonadIO m, TreeViewK a, TreeModelK b) => a -> Maybe b -> m () Source

treeViewSetReorderable

data TreeViewSetReorderableMethodInfo Source

Instances

((~) * signature (Bool -> m ()), MonadIO m, TreeViewK a) => MethodInfo * TreeViewSetReorderableMethodInfo a signature Source 

treeViewSetRowSeparatorFunc

treeViewSetRubberBanding

treeViewSetRulesHint

data TreeViewSetRulesHintMethodInfo Source

Instances

((~) * signature (Bool -> m ()), MonadIO m, TreeViewK a) => MethodInfo * TreeViewSetRulesHintMethodInfo a signature Source 

treeViewSetRulesHint :: (MonadIO m, TreeViewK a) => a -> Bool -> m () Source

Deprecated: (Since version 3.14)

treeViewSetSearchColumn

data TreeViewSetSearchColumnMethodInfo Source

Instances

((~) * signature (Int32 -> m ()), MonadIO m, TreeViewK a) => MethodInfo * TreeViewSetSearchColumnMethodInfo a signature Source 

treeViewSetSearchEntry

data TreeViewSetSearchEntryMethodInfo Source

Instances

((~) * signature (Maybe b -> m ()), MonadIO m, TreeViewK a, EntryK b) => MethodInfo * TreeViewSetSearchEntryMethodInfo a signature Source 

treeViewSetSearchEqualFunc

treeViewSetSearchPositionFunc

treeViewSetShowExpanders

treeViewSetTooltipCell

treeViewSetTooltipColumn

treeViewSetTooltipRow

data TreeViewSetTooltipRowMethodInfo Source

Instances

((~) * signature (b -> TreePath -> m ()), MonadIO m, TreeViewK a, TooltipK b) => MethodInfo * TreeViewSetTooltipRowMethodInfo a signature Source 

treeViewSetVadjustment

data TreeViewSetVadjustmentMethodInfo Source

Instances

((~) * signature (Maybe b -> m ()), MonadIO m, TreeViewK a, AdjustmentK b) => MethodInfo * TreeViewSetVadjustmentMethodInfo a signature Source 

treeViewSetVadjustment :: (MonadIO m, TreeViewK a, AdjustmentK b) => a -> Maybe b -> m () Source

Deprecated: (Since version 3.0)Use gtk_scrollable_set_vadjustment()

treeViewUnsetRowsDragDest

treeViewUnsetRowsDragSource

Properties

ActivateOnSingleClick

EnableGridLines

EnableSearch

EnableTreeLines

ExpanderColumn

FixedHeightMode

HeadersClickable

HeadersVisible

HoverExpand

HoverSelection

LevelIndentation

Model

setTreeViewModel :: (MonadIO m, TreeViewK o, TreeModelK a) => o -> a -> m () Source

Reorderable

RubberBanding

RulesHint

SearchColumn

ShowExpanders

TooltipColumn

Signals

ColumnsChanged

CursorChanged

ExpandCollapseCursorRow

MoveCursor

RowActivated

RowCollapsed

RowExpanded

SelectAll

SelectCursorParent

SelectCursorRow

StartInteractiveSearch

TestCollapseRow

TestExpandRow

ToggleCursorRow

UnselectAll